You might try the free Microsoft Malicious Software Removal Tool. You can just run it from their site--you don't have to download it. The Tool is a couple of months behind, so if this is a real new virus, it won't help. It also won't help unless a virus is widespread/real bad. It's at: https://www.microsoft.com/security/malwareremove/default.mspx. Most likely, you have a couple of associated infections. A lot of the current bad stuff has more than one malware. Before starting, make sure you have all your Windows patches. Good luck. Regards, |
